Applications
3-methyl-1,4-heptadiene (CAS 1603-01-6) is an unsaturated hydrocarbon primarily used as an industrial intermediate and a reactive diene in organic synthesis. It serves as a building block for the preparation of specialty polymers and resins, where its diene functionality enables polymerization and crosslinking. It is also used as a reactive feedstock in coatings and inks formulations, enabling post-application curing or crosslinking. The compound may be evaluated for fragrance applications as an odorant or perfumery ingredient, and it can be considered in other industrial manufacturing contexts where unsaturated dienes are advantageous. Its use is typically subject to local regulations and formulation limits.
